Bill Summary

As introduced, extends from January 1 to 15, the deadline by which the wildlife resources agency must submit to legislative committees with subject matter jurisdiction over natural resources a written report containing the estimated acreage managed by the agency that has been closed to recreational hunting and fishing during the previous fiscal year and the reasons for the closures; the estimated acreage managed by the agency that was opened to recreational hunting and fishing to compensate for the acreage that was so closed; and the estimated acreage of new public hunting and fishing lands added. - Amends TCA Title 70.

AI Summary

This bill amends Tennessee's wildlife resources law by changing the deadline for an annual reporting requirement. Specifically, the bill shifts the deadline for the wildlife resources agency to submit a comprehensive report to legislative committees from January 1 to January 15 each year. The required report must detail the acreage of land managed by the agency that was closed to recreational hunting and fishing during the previous fiscal year, including the reasons for those closures. The report must also include information about any acreage reopened to recreational hunting and fishing to compensate for closed areas, as well as the estimated acreage of new public hunting and fishing lands added. The bill will take effect on July 1, 2025, providing the wildlife agency with additional time to compile and submit its annual land management report to the relevant legislative committees.
